Insider Buying: Mexico Fund (NYSE:MXF) Major Shareholder Acquires 29,500 Shares of Stock

Mexico Fund, Inc. (The) (NYSE:MXFGet Free Report) major shareholder Saba Capital Management, L.P. bought 29,500 shares of the business’s stock in a transaction on Friday, June 12th. The shares were bought at an average cost of $22.30 per share, for a total transaction of $657,850.00. Following the completion of the acquisition, the insider directly owned 2,234,685 shares in the company, valued at approximately $49,833,475.50. This trade represents a 1.34% increase in their position. The purchase was disclosed in a fil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which can be accessed through this link. Large shareholders that own at least 10% of a company’s stock are required to disclose their sales and purchases with the SEC.

The Mexico Fund, Inc (NYSE: MXF) is a closed-end management investment company that seeks long-term capital appreciation through exposure to Mexican securities. The fund primarily invests in equity instruments of companies organized or principally operating in Mexico, spanning a range of sectors such as financial services, consumer goods, industrials and energy. It may also allocate portions of its portfolio to fixed-income securities, including government and corporate bonds, when attractive opportunities arise.
